We are having a problem with the name we came up with for our new gambling website...

The team came up with Velvetdeck.com, we like it but, we are afraid that in the future people will abbreviate our name to VD, which we think will be bad because VD is also venerial disease.
But its a cool sexy name that works with the theme of our site. Some of the other guys think the VD abbreviation may be adventagous because "bad publicity is good publicity"

Otherwise we came up with the name Paybackcity.com Which is a more neutral and broad name for future business ventures. I just like this name, they like the other.

Thanks for any help

    In the end any name should deliver to the product benefit - "you could win" Chance your luck, oblique fancy names are what you make of them (if you have heaps to spend on promotion), what does paybackcity mean? are you offering a hitman service?
    You are a gambling site, make it obvious
